Common Navigation Pitfalls and How to Avoid Them
Have you ever found yourself tangled in endless dropdowns or faced with unclear labels that leave you guessing where to click next? It’s a common frustration that can turn a promising site into a dead end. Thankfully, good design principles help mitigate these issues by prioritizing clarity and logical flow.
Here are some practical tips for smoother navigation on any website, whether it’s a complex service hub or a straightforward informational page:
- Look for consistent layout: Familiar placement of menus and buttons reduces cognitive load.
- Trust clear labels: Menus should use straightforward language rather than vague or technical terms.
- Use built-in search wisely: A well-functioning search bar can save you time, but only if it’s accurate and responsive.
- Don’t hesitate to use breadcrumbs: They help you keep track of where you are in the site hierarchy.
- Check for mobile responsiveness: Many users browse on phones, so ease of use on smaller screens is essential.
